The votes are tallied and the winners chosen, but you can still enjoy the amazing films from the 2019 Film Festival below.
Audible Static
When a young boy with a speech impediment falls in love, he takes extreme measures to overcome his adversary.
All Square: Justice Served in a Sandwich
Emily Hunt Turner challenges the narrative that stems from having a criminal record through her restaurant, All Square.
Atlantic City
Two Texas drifters test their friendship when one wants to head north and find his estranged mother.
Balloon Girl
A young girl realizes the art of participating in small acts of kindness.
Beacon
When a pilgrim's arrival disrupts the congregation, one member begins to question everything.
Blank Canvas
Two disparate strangers form an unlikely bond on a rooftop after experiencing traumatic situations.
BT Lives in the Stitch
An involved highschool teacher creates a knitting group that doubles as an after school safe haven for students.
Charlotte and Charlie
As a young woman's eyesight begins to fade, so does her ability to operate her most prized possession: her car.
Heroine of Hope
In hope of assisting those stuck in the systems of addiction and prostitution, Scarlett titles herself "Momma" to improve the women's livelihood.
Hidden Vote | Are Gay Rights Gun Rights?
A queer couple lives in harmony, despite their conflicting political opinions.
Into My Life
Cassandra appreciates her late mother's creativity by examining the Super-8 films she shot of 1960s-80s Brooklyn.
Joan
Despite a life-altering diagnosis, Joan reflects in pride of her beautiful 60 years.
Love Wins
A heartwarming love story which celebrates a relationship that was once forbidden.
Ode to Pablo
Challenged to a basketball game, a deaf Latino boy connects with another player, despite the evident language barrier.
Paris Blues in Harlem
An edgy woman attempts to convince her granddad to abandon his jazz club's legacy for a mound of cash.
Rani
A Pakistani transgender woman welcomes life's challenges in order to care for an abandoned child.
The Children of Central City
A look at the impact growing up surrounded by violence in inner city, New Orleans.
The Country Priest
The impending border wall threatens a chapel and a local priest in Mission, Texas.
The Jump
Despite societal pressures to choose a college major, Luna explores opportunities by simply moving forward.
The Moon and the Night
In rural Hawaii, a teenage girl must confront her father after he enters her beloved pet in a dog fight.
The Shepherd of the Stars
When the world began, a shepard and his dog traveled by foot each day to blow in a magic horn and light the night sky.
Under the Milky Way
Travel to the dark skies prairie of Nebraska and reconnect with nature's midnight majesty.
Who Are You?
When a writer has a disastrous creative block, a delivery girl arrives with a mysterious box.
yoox̲atuwatánk (We Speak)
Ranging from scenic views to tribal ceremonies, we delve into the lessons passed on through an indigenous ancestry.
Young Adult
A teenager with cerebral palsy stops at nothing to connect with her first love.
